Abstract

The utility model relates to the technical field of denture mold clamping devices, in particular to an adjustable denture mold clamping device which comprises a straight plate, wherein one side of the outer wall of the straight plate is fixedly connected with a square plate, one end of the square plate is attached with a denture mold, the other side of the outer wall of the straight plate is fixedly connected with a vertical plate, the bottom of the straight plate below the vertical plate is fixedly connected with a bottom plate, and one side of the top of the bottom plate is fixedly connected with a plate body. Background
Denture dies are generally used for more intuitively displaying the structure and arrangement of the inside of teeth, facilitating the corresponding observation and understanding of medical staff, facilitating the comparison with the denture dies after the orthodontic treatment, and more clearly knowing the orthodontic condition, and the denture dies are generally installed on a clamping device for viewing.
The existing adjustable denture mould clamping device (application number: 202220554048.7) is convenient for clamp and fix the denture mould, so that the denture mould is prevented from loosening in the clamping device, accurate pairing of the denture mould at the upper portion and the lower portion is facilitated to be displayed in the clamping device, the device still exists, when the denture mould is displayed, the denture is required to be fixed by using the clamping device, people's observation is facilitated, the device rotates a threaded rod through staff, the fixing of the denture mould is realized, the operation is inconvenient, the staff is required to rotate more turns of the threaded rod due to the fixing mode of the threaded rod, the clamping efficiency of the denture mould is lower, the denture mould is sometimes required to be positioned in the inside for displaying when the denture mould is displayed, the device cannot rotate the denture mould above, and then the denture mould above is positioned in the inside for displaying the teeth and is not clear enough, so that the observation of the staff on the denture mould is influenced.

Working principle:
firstly, the clamping plate 2a2 is pressed outwards, the clamping plate 2a2 is further rotated, the denture mould 9 is placed on the outer wall of the square plate 12, the clamping plate 2a2 is loosened, the first spring 2a1 drives the vertical block 2a5 to move inwards, the vertical block 2a5 drives the round block 2a3 to move inwards, the round block 2a3 drives the clamping plate 2a2 to rotate, then the denture mould 9 is clamped and fixed, the rotating plate 7 is rotated, then the denture mould 9 above can be rotated, when the teeth of the denture mould 9 above are needed to be observed, the straight rod 304 is pulled leftwards, the straight rod 304 is moved out of the groove of the curved block 301, the curved block 301 is rotated, the curved block 301 drives the straight plate 4 above to rotate, then the denture mould 9 above is rotated, all the teeth inside the denture mould 9 above are displayed, and the teeth inside the denture mould 9 above are displayed more clearly.
